January 2, 2024 - One of my favorite games that I play with faculty and students to get them to consider how machine learning and neural networks function is Google’s Quick, Draw! The timed doodling game where a user tries to draw an image and the AI tries to guess it based off of its training data is an excellent and fast opportunity to show how the technology functions—input, prediction, then output.
